From April through June of 2018, there were two homes sold, with a median sale price of $30,000 - a 68.9% decrease over the $96,500 median sale price for the same period of the previous year. There were eight homes sold in Dexter in the second quarter of 2017.
The median sales tax in Dexter for the most recent year with available data, 2017, was $1,374, approximately 4.6% of the median home sale price for the second quarter of 2018.
